The Regional Secretariat for Education and Culture, through the Regional Directorate for Culture, in collaboration with the National Cultural Centre promotes the "Meeting with Writers" dedicated to Teolinda Gersão and Djaimilia Pereira de Almeida next Thursday, November 24.
The session takes place at Ponta Delgada Public Library and Regional Archive at 6:30 PM. The presentation will be made by Leonor Sampaio and Madalena Teixeira da Silva, professors at the University of the Azores.
Teolinda Gersão studied at the Universities of Coimbra, Tübingen and Berlin. As lecturer, she taught Portuguese at the Technical University of Berlin. She held the position of full professor at Universidade Nova de Lisboa (New University), where she taught German Literature and Comparative Literature.
As the author of 14 fiction books, translated into 11 languages, Teolinda Gersão won twice the PEN Club Fiction Prize for the works "O silêncio" and "O cavalo de sol." She was also the recipient of various prizes: Grand Prix of Romance and Novel of the Portuguese Writers Association (EPA), Fernando Namora Prize, Camilo Castelo Branco Grand Prize, Máxima Literature Prize, Inês de Castro Foundation Prize, Ciranda Prize and António Quadros Foundation Prize.
In 2004, Teolinda Gersão was resident writer at the University of Berkeley. Some of her books were adapted to theatre plays and were staged in Portugal, Germany and Romania.
Djaimilia Pereira de Almeida was born in Luanda. She is a new name in Portuguese literature, having started her literary career with the work titled as "Esse cabelo." This book crosses memories, essay and fiction; it stems from the relationship between a young girl and her curly hair.
She holds a PhD in Literary Theory from the Faculty of Social and Human Sciences of Universidade Nova de Lisboa (New University of Lisbon). Djaimilia Pereira de Almeida began writing this book when she left the academic life.
